Gwangju Nam-gu Replaces Soundproof Wall Near Purugil with Transparent One

[Asia Economy Honam Reporting Headquarters Reporter Park Jin-hyung] The steel temporary soundproof wall surrounding the Blue Road Park walking trail near the Street Food Zone in Baegun Square, Nam-gu, Gwangju Metropolitan City, will be replaced with a transparent soundproof wall.


This is to minimize the damage to Baekyang-ro merchants operating stores around the Blue Road Park walking trail opposite Nam-gu Office.


According to Nam-gu on the 23rd, the replacement work of the steel temporary soundproof wall in Blue Road Park near the Street Food Zone is expected to begin at the end of this month.


Currently, a long gray steel temporary soundproof wall about 255m in length and 3.5m in height is installed from in front of Moa Obstetrics and Gynecology in Blue Road Park to the section opposite Nam Gwangju Nonghyup.


The soundproof wall was installed last February by the Gwangju Urban Railway Construction Headquarters to block noise and dust for the construction of Subway Line 2.


After the steel temporary soundproof wall was installed, store owners operating on Baekyang-ro complained of many management difficulties.


The Baekyang-ro Merchants' Association raised this complaint to the Urban Railway Construction Headquarters in July, stating that large-scale construction projects, including the Baegun Square sewer pipe construction and the Subway Line 2 construction, have been continuously carried out around the Blue Road Park walking trail for over four years, forcing them to endure the damage.


In particular, with the installation of the steel temporary soundproof wall last February, the high barrier between Daenam-daero and the Blue Road Park walking trail caused the stores to be isolated like a remote island, as they were not exposed to the outside.


Nam-gu decided to replace it with a transparent soundproof wall so that stores around the Blue Road Park walking trail and Baekyang-ro area can be visible from the Daenam-daero direction, to resolve the grievances of the Baekyang-ro Merchants' Association and to facilitate the smooth progress of the Subway Line 2 construction.


A Nam-gu official stated, “We plan to start construction at the end of September and quickly complete the installation of the transparent soundproof wall. Once the construction is completed, the Baekyang-ro stores and the Street Food Zone area around the Blue Road Park walking trail will be clearly visible, which is expected to alleviate the sense of isolation from the outside.”
